About the company

SalonCentric, a subsidiary of L’Oreal USA, is the premiere distributor of salon professional products in the United States. Through its hundreds of stores, national field sales force, and sub-distribution network, SalonCentric promotes the finest professional beauty brands and educates stylists on the latest products and trends.
